SSCC softball players earn conference honors

Eight players on the Southern State Community College softball team were honored recently by the Ohio Collegiate Athletic Conference (OCAC) and the United States Collegiate Athletic Association (USCAA).
The following SSCC athletes were named as postseason award winners by the OCAC: Jennifer Middleton, a graduate of Hillsboro High School, First Team All-Conference; Amber Frazer, a graduate of Whiteoak High School, Second Team All-Conference; Skyelyn Lucas, a graduate of Whiteoak High School, Second Team All-Conference; Sarah Love, a graduate of Blanchester High School, Second Team All-Conference; Breanne Johnson, a graduate of Miami Trace High School, Second Team All-Conference; Shaylyn Sluss, a graduate of Hillsboro High School, honorable mention; Taryn Christy, a graduate of Whiteoak High School, honorable mention; and Juanita Nichols, a graduate of Whiteoak High School, Freshman of the Year.
The USCAA All-Academic Team Award is given to student athletes—sophomores, juniors and seniors—who have excelled off by the field by achieving at least a 3.5 grade point average. Whiteoak graduate Amber Frazer was awarded the honor.
The SSCC Patriots women’s softball team is coached by Randy Sanders with assistance from Kristin Kissinger.
